Abstract
This chapter is a story of another Italy. It is an Italy that is unknown to most people, far removed from the scandals and media preoccupations that inevitably affect our perception of the reality. It is the story of a group of individuals who, day after day, work in the background in the pursuit of a better world, based on the ideals of social justice and common good. It is the story of Banca Etica, an Italian cooperative bank, which is first and foremost a community of people who have transformed the dream of ethical banking into a reality. This is the story of a successful bank whose activities consider important ethical issues, such as respect for the environment, solidarity, and responsible investing, while maintaining continuous and stable positive financial performance. This chapter is a tribute to those men and women who contributed to the creation and the development of Banca Etica, and also to everyone before and since who has nurtured an understanding of economics and business centred on the intrinsic human values.
